Namibia - Import of Raw Beet Sugar
Since 2014, Namibia Import of Raw Beet Sugar fell by 29.8%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 28 among other countries in Import of Raw Beet Sugar with $1,968,872.99. Namibia is overtaken by Russia, which was number 27 with $2,054,633.78 and is followed by Samoa with $1,917,727.46. Saudi Arabia topped the ranking with $40,822,008.34 in 2019, that is an increase of 2,841% compared to 2018. Israel, Ireland and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kyrgyzstan witnessed the best average annual growth at +406.1% per year, while Sri Lanka recorded the worst performance at -83.3% per year.
